パラオ地元紙Tia Belauにあった、クアルテイ医師による気になるコメンタリーである。

FYI: FOR YOUR ISLAND, WHO?

By Stevenson Kuartei, MD

Words from Orakidorm, Tia Belau

12 Nov 2015

(全文は下記に)

あなたの島のために。で始まる3つのショートコメントである。がどれも中国人による観光業などのパラオへの負の影響に警鐘を鳴らしている。

FYI: FOR YOUR ISLAND, WHO?

By Stevenson Kuartei, MD

Words from Orakidorm, Tia Belau

12 Nov 2015

The following 3 articles were writing recently in our local newspapers and forwarded to the Pacific Island Report. The 1st article was on October 6, “Salvage Company To Remove Abandoned Cruise Ship from Palau: Philippines company to take possession of Chines ‘Xian Ni’.” The 2nd was on November 10, 2015, “Palau Senate Calls For Investigation Into Non-Citizens In Tourism: Impact of heavy involvement of foreigners in sector needs exploration.” And the 3rd is November 11, 2015, “Chinese Nationals In Palau Form Association: Group to strengthen relations between Palau, PRC.”

For Your Island: Rumors has it that the Chinese ship Xian Ni is currently embarked at the Malakal port getting “refurbished” before its forbidden voyage to the Philippines. Rumors and published in the newspaper is that it was “rat infested” but now embarked without rat guards. Rumors has it that it was here at Palau’s invitation and after being registered by the Palau Ship Registrar and then “abandoned” close to Kuabesngas for many months. Rumors have it that it was given a last ultimatum to be removed or pay $1,000/day and has violated that ultimatum. So was there criminal violation somewhere or not? Or may be all of these are just true rumors.

For Your Island: Now there are rumors that Non-Citizens are “heavily involved in the tourism industry”. There are also rumors that “business people from a certain country are splitting their money and giving $9,999.99 to other passengers” to bring through customs so that they do not have to declare it. After arrival to Palau they collect it back and pay commission to the carriers. It is rumored that this is how they buy all of these huge boats, gigantic buses, buildings and lease lands. It is also rumored that even when they bring more than $10,000 knowingly violating the law, they are charged merely 3% and they the money are returned and the violators are not convicted. Or maybe all of these are just true rumors.

For Your Island: Rumors have it that a new association is being formed for goodwill and corporate responsibility. Rumors and published in the articles said, “we are not here for money only but for friendship”. Rumors have it that Palau’s friends, the US of A, Japan and the Republic of China, Taiwan are extremely happy about this. Rumors have it that the new Palau-China United Association will have Palauan board members. Rumors have it that the reason why all the Palauan owned Bangladeshi managed stores closed when the man Bangladesh died at the hospital is because the Palauan owners decided so. That tells you who the real owners are, the Banglauans. Or maybe these are just true rumors.

Orakidorm, all these rumors are nauseating. The truth is that Xian Ni is in Palau illegally in the first place. How is it getting out without anyone being held accountable? Secondly the tourism industry is inundated with lots to illegal and irregular activities that need cleaning up because it is damaging Palau’s reputation and pushing local people to the periphery. And thirdly, Palau need to accord due respect and commitment to those countries that it has diplomatic relationship with, that have been established through out the years. It is easy for Small Island Developing States like Palau to sit by and allow big countries to come in and push their agenda in the name of “goodwill” while exploiting the local populations. Someone has to take charge and it can’t be the Banglauans. Or may be these are just true rumors.
